Abstract
The present invention relates to a kind of comfort type color ultrasonic devices with pooling feature, including display screen, host, pedestal, cable, detecting head, buckle and four movable pulleys, it further include buffer gear and heating mechanism, the buffer gear includes Buffer Unit and two accessory parts, the Buffer Unit includes buffer bar and two buffer cells, the buffer cell includes buffer stopper, connecting rod and the first spring, the heating mechanism includes heating box and fixed bin, heating component is equipped in the fixed bin, the heating component includes hose, rotation box, two driving units and two heating units, the comfort type color ultrasonic devices with pooling feature pass through buffer gear, buffering work can be carried out to host, host is avoided to shake when moving, influence the normal work of host internal electronic element, pass through heating mechanism, Heating work can be carried out to detecting head, avoid directly contacting patient when detecting head temperature is too low, bring discomfort to patient.

Background technique
Color ultrasonic devices abbreviation color ultrasound refers to black-and-white B high-definition along with color Doppler, color Doppler
Ultrasound is usually to carry out LDA signal processor with autocorrelation technique, and the blood flow signal that autocorrelation technique is obtained is through coloud coding
It is superimposed in real time afterwards on 2d, that is, forms Color Doppler Ultrasonic picture.
When moving, when encountering the situation of ground injustice, host is easy to happen vibration to existing color ultrasonic devices, from
And image is caused to the normal work of the electronic component inside host, the safety of equipment is reduced, moreover, existing coloured silk
The detecting head of color diasonograph is usually outdoor layout, causes the temperature of detecting head lower, if directly with the skin of patient
Contact, can bring sense of discomfort to patient, reduce the comfort of equipment.
